The Natural Cycle of Life and Death

small dead animals

Life on Earth follows a continuous cycle that includes birth, growth, death, and renewal. Small animals are a key part of this cycle. Because they reproduce quickly and have shorter lifespans than larger animals, their populations constantly change.

When a small animal dies, its body becomes part of a complex process called decomposition. Decomposers such as bacteria, fungi, and insects break down the animal’s tissues. This process releases nutrients like nitrogen, phosphorus, and carbon back into the environment.

These nutrients then become available to plants, which use them to grow. Herbivores eat the plants, carnivores eat the herbivores, and the cycle continues. Without the breakdown of dead organisms, nutrients would become trapped in bodies and ecosystems would slowly collapse.

Small dead animals are particularly important because they appear in large numbers. Their bodies provide regular and steady sources of nutrients that help maintain ecological balance.

The Role of Decomposers in Breaking Down Dead Animals

Decomposition is one of the most important processes in nature, and decomposers are the organisms responsible for carrying it out. Without decomposers, dead animals would accumulate and disrupt ecosystems.

Bacteria are among the first decomposers to act on dead animals. These microscopic organisms break down tissues and release chemicals that begin the decomposition process.

Fungi also play a major role in breaking down organic material. They spread through dead bodies and absorb nutrients as they grow. This helps speed up the decomposition process.

Insects such as beetles, ants, and flies contribute by consuming soft tissues and spreading bacteria. Some insects lay eggs in dead animals, and their larvae help break down the remains even further.

Together, these decomposers transform small dead animals into nutrients that return to the soil and support new life.

Small Dead Animals in Scientific Research

Small dead animals are sometimes studied by scientists to understand ecosystems, diseases, and environmental changes. Researchers may examine animal remains to learn about population health and habitat conditions.

For example, studying dead birds can help scientists detect environmental pollution or disease outbreaks. Certain chemicals accumulate in animal tissues, allowing researchers to measure environmental contamination.

Researchers also analyze small animal remains to understand predator-prey relationships. Examining bones and tissues can reveal which species are interacting within an ecosystem.

In addition, small dead animals help scientists study decomposition and nutrient cycles. By observing how quickly animals break down, researchers gain insights into soil health and microbial activity.

These studies contribute to our understanding of how ecosystems function and how human activity may be affecting them.

Health and Safety Concerns

While small dead animals are a natural part of the environment, they can sometimes pose health risks if handled improperly. Decaying animals may carry bacteria or parasites that can cause illness.

It is important to avoid touching dead animals with bare hands. If removal is necessary, gloves and proper tools should be used.

Dead animals should be placed in sealed bags before disposal. This helps prevent the spread of odors and reduces the risk of contamination.

In some cases, local authorities or animal control services may handle dead animal removal. This is especially important if the animal is large or located in a public area.

Taking basic safety precautions helps protect both people and the environment.
